What are the issues agreed upon by the four schools of thought, and can they be found in a book, audio recordings, or any other source, divided by jurisprudential chapters such as prayer and fasting?

Scholars have paid great attention to issues of Ijma' (consensus), with some dedicating entire works to it, such as Ibn al-Mundhir's al-Ijma' and Ibn Hazm's Maratib al-Ijma'. Among the best of these is Ibn al-Qattan's al-Iqna' fi Masa'il al-Ijma'. Some scholars mention these issues before addressing matters of disagreement. Important resources for Ijma' include comparative jurisprudence books and commentary works. A useful contemporary book is Mawsu'at al-Ijma' fi al-Fiqh al-Islami by Sa'di Abu Jayb. It should be noted that citing Ijma' may, in fact, refer to the opinion of the majority, and a scholar might cite Ijma' due to unawareness of a differing opinion. This is why Ibn Taymiyyah criticized Ibn Hazm's Maratib al-Ijma'.
